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Nebraska in 2013

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Refinancing 54,393 $9,660,623,000 $177,000 $98,750,000 $79,000 $9,697,000
Home Purchase 36,259 $5,387,953,000 $148,000 $19,800,000 $70,000 $9,650,000
Home Improvement 6,771 $391,421,000 $57,000 $13,704,000 $76,000 $1,847,000

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 71,086 $9,558,832,000 $134,000 $4,700,000 $86,000 $9,697,000
Not applicable 12,067 $4,123,793,000 $341,000 $98,750,000 $15,000 $1,548,000
Not Provided 7,129 $977,755,000 $137,000 $13,704,000 $82,000 $3,670,000
Hispanic 3,840 $370,050,000 $96,000 $1,262,000 $55,000 $1,214,000
Black or African American 1,618 $176,014,000 $108,000 $1,052,000 $64,000 $3,812,000
Asian 1,353 $192,977,000 $142,000 $1,572,000 $83,000 $1,600,000
American Indian or Alaskan Native 234 $27,400,000 $117,000 $530,000 $74,000 $1,280,000
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ander 96 $13,176,000 $137,000 $378,000 $93,000 $540,000

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 72,036 $9,787,063,000 $135,000 $19,800,000 $87,000 $9,697,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 15,816 $4,148,262,000 $262,000 $98,750,000 $40,000 $1,026,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 7,737 $1,316,042,000 $170,000 $860,000 $50,000 $633,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 1,834 $188,630,000 $102,000 $1,000,000 $34,000 $875,000

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 56,003 $7,931,827,000 $141,000 $19,800,000 $86,000 $9,650,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 18,507 $4,740,431,000 $256,000 $98,750,000 $43,000 $1,131,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 11,781 $1,262,161,000 $107,000 $5,380,000 $68,000 $9,697,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 6,203 $884,853,000 $142,000 $13,704,000 $84,000 $4,993,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 3,142 $400,838,000 $127,000 $2,833,000 $95,000 $5,404,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 1,786 $219,652,000 $122,000 $1,000,000 $74,000 $1,672,000
Preapproval Denied by Financial Institution 1 $235,000 $235,000 $235,000 $195,000 $195,000
Preapproval Approved but not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Credit History 2,897 $224,054,000 $77,000 $1,400,000 $63,000 $1,626,000
Debt-To-Income Ratio 1,835 $199,167,000 $108,000 $1,098,000 $49,000 $673,000
Collateral 1,698 $207,588,000 $122,000 $1,485,000 $83,000 $1,622,000
Other 822 $89,882,000 $109,000 $5,380,000 $69,000 $1,129,000
Credit Application Incomplete 659 $86,634,000 $131,000 $655,000 $82,000 $754,000
Unverifiable Information 275 $33,263,000 $120,000 $586,000 $73,000 $964,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 238 $28,795,000 $120,000 $850,000 $55,000 $548,000
Employment History 130 $13,691,000 $105,000 $335,000 $43,000 $130,000
Mortgage Insurance Denied 12 $1,317,000 $109,000 $170,000 $97,000 $162,000
